Original artwork description
"Shapes of Wonder 02" is a visual exploration of the whimsical and boundless imagination of a child, inspired by the playful spontaneity of drawing a fish underwater. The painting reflects how children perceive their environment—not merely as a reflection of reality but as a dreamlike realm where everyday objects transform into magical worlds. In this piece, the shape of a fish becomes an abstract form, blending fluidly with the landscape of an underwater fantasy—where colors, shapes, and patterns swim freely, unburdened by rules or logic.
The vibrant palette—pinks, greens, oranges, and blues—creates a kaleidoscopic landscape that hints at a fairy-tale underwater world. The childlike joy in mark-making is evident in the irregular patches and layers of color, each suggesting fragments of imagined things: coral reefs, playful sea creatures, hidden treasures, and magical underwater forests. These elements are left abstract to capture the free-flowing nature of a child’s mind, where shapes don’t conform to reality but morph into whatever the heart desires.
The gray background adds contrast, evoking a dream-like suspension, as if this fantastical world is floating just beneath the surface of everyday life. Through this painting, I aim to immerse the viewer in a playful and enchanting space—one that celebrates the unstructured joy of child art and the beauty of seeing the world with wonder, where even a fish underwater becomes an entire universe of possibilities.
